**Bouncehawk Environments**

Bouncehawk (our email bounce processor) runs in three environments: sandbox, staging, and prod. Sandbox eats synthetic bounces only, staging mirrors a slice of real traffic, and prod handles the full firehose. Retry queues differ per environment, so don't copy settings blindly between them. The current prod environment runs with the following values.

deployment values, yadug-bawif:
[framir]
team = pelox
access_code = ac_a38ab2
owner = tamion.julael
host = framir.tolvaqlabs.test
port = 11211
peer = tammir.zemvargrid.local
salt = 2215ef03
pin = 1541

14:05 — The quarterly archive job at Brindlemere began moving cold storage buckets to the Coldvault tier. The job's manifest generator, recently refactored, silently skipped buckets whose names contained uppercase characters, so 112 of 340 buckets were marked archived without being copied. Lifecycle rules then deleted the originals. For new team members: this is why we now require a checksum reconciliation pass before any deletion step. The faulty manifest generator shipped in the build recorded here.

session token of tajef-bageg = htk21_5d90d574934f3ccae6437

**Vendor note: GraphTangle**

Heads up — our contract with Quillbrook Systems for the GraphTangle dependency visualizer renews next quarter. They've been responsive, but the v4 licence changes how seats are counted, so loop in procurement before the release freeze. Renders have been stable since the January patch. If you need pricing details or the renewal draft, ping their account rep.

billing contact of yawip-yadup = druath.casdor@nelvrolabs.internal